DHAKA, April 15, 2025 (BSS)—Bangladesh Women’s team captain Nigar Sultana Joty and top order batter Sharmin Akter Supta have attained career-best positions in the ICC ODI batting rankings.
The reward came following their fine performances in the first two matches of the 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up Qualifier being played in Lahore.
Joty and Sharmin, who had partnered in a 152-run third wicket stand, got their team off to an impressive start with a 178-run victory over Thailand. The margin of the victory marked Bangladesh’s largest ever in their history.
In the second match, Bangladesh beat Ireland by two wickets in a thrilling contest, where the duo also made significant contributions.
Joty’s Player of the Match effort of 101 in match against Thailand and a knock of 51 against Ireland, have lifted her 16 places to 17th position while Sharmin’s scores of 94 not out against Thailand and 24 versus Ireland see her gain 11 slots and reach 29th position.
Bangladesh’s Rabeya Khan (up seven places to 23rd) and Fahima Khatun (up three places to 48th) have also made notable progress.
